The world of wheel accessories is vast, with countless brands vying for your attention. But who makes the best? There’s no single definitive answer, as the “best” depends on your specific needs, budget, and car model. However, this guide will highlight some of the top contenders in the wheel accessory arena:
Luxury and Performance:
- HRE: Renowned for their high-performance forged wheels, HRE offers a luxurious and lightweight option for discerning car enthusiasts. Their focus is on precision engineering and cutting-edge designs.
- BBS: Another leader in the performance wheel market, BBS offers a range of forged and cast alloy wheels known for their durability, lightweight construction, and iconic motorsport heritage.
Aftermarket and Customization:
- Vossen: A popular choice for those seeking a customized look, Vossen offers a wide variety of alloy wheel styles and finishes, including bold colors and unique spoke patterns.
- Rotiform: Another brand known for its customization options, Rotiform allows you to personalize wheel sizes, widths, offsets, and finishes to create a truly unique look for your car.
OEM Replacements and Budget-Friendly Options:
- OE Wheels: Many car manufacturers offer genuine O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) replacement wheels. These ensure a perfect fit for your car and maintain the original look.
- Discount Tire: This major tire retailer also offers a wide selection of affordably priced aftermarket wheels and hubcaps from various brands.
Security and Functionality:
- McGard: A leading manufacturer of high-security lug nuts and locks, McGard offers a variety of styles and sizes to deter theft and protect your wheels.
- Schrader: A well-known brand for tire pressure monitoring systems (TPMS) sensors and accessories, Schrader ensures your TPMS system functions properly for optimal safety and fuel efficiency.
